Transformation Through Surrender

This combination of cards signifies a period of profound change and introspection. It suggests that embracing uncertainty and letting go of old ways is essential for growth and clarity.

All Upright

When all three cards are upright, they highlight a transformative phase where letting go of the past allows for new perspectives to emerge. The Hanged Man encourages surrender and patience, while Death signifies the end of a cycle, making way for rebirth. The Two of Swords urges you to confront inner conflicts and make decisions that align with this new path.

The Hanged Man Reversed

When The Hanged Man is reversed, it suggests a resistance to change and an inability to see things from a new perspective. This stagnation may hinder personal growth and delay necessary transformations. It’s a call to examine what fears or attachments are preventing you from moving forward.

Death Reversed

With Death reversed, there may be an unwillingness to let go, leading to a cycle of stagnation or fear of the unknown. This resistance to change can manifest as clinging to outdated beliefs or relationships. Acknowledging the need for transformation is crucial to avoid prolonged discomfort.

Two of Swords Reversed

The Two of Swords reversed indicates confusion and indecision, often stemming from a fear of confronting difficult truths. This card warns of avoiding necessary choices, which can lead to emotional turmoil. It highlights the importance of addressing inner conflicts to regain clarity and direction.

All Reversed

When all three cards are reversed, the reading reflects a significant struggle with change and decision-making. There is a clear resistance to the transformative energies at play, leading to confusion and stagnation. It’s essential to confront fears and embrace the discomfort that comes with change to unlock personal growth.

Love & Relationships

In relationships, this combination suggests that unresolved issues and a reluctance to let go of the past are causing stagnation. It may be time to acknowledge the need for change and open up to new possibilities. Honest communication and a willingness to confront fears can lead to deeper connections.

Career & Finances

Professionally, this reading indicates a standstill that may result from fear of taking risks or making necessary changes. It’s crucial to face any indecision head-on and consider whether current paths align with your true goals. Embracing transformation can lead to new opportunities and growth.

Advice

The advice here is to practice patience and self-reflection as you navigate this period of uncertainty. Embrace the discomfort of change and allow yourself to let go of what no longer serves you. Seek clarity in your decisions, and don’t shy away from confronting difficult emotions.
